如何编程手机游戏?手把手教你手机游戏开发的完整指南
一、如何编程手机游戏?手把手教你手机游戏开发的完整指南
引言:探索手机游戏开发的奥秘
近年来,随着智能手机的普及,手机游戏已经成为人们日常生活中不可或缺的一部分。设计一款成功的手机游戏成为了许多开发者和创作者的梦想。那么,究竟如何才能编程出一款妙趣横生、炫酷无比的手机游戏呢?本文将从游戏开发的基本流程、常用工具和技术、以及一些开发技巧进行全面而系统的介绍,带领读者一步步探索手机游戏开发的奥秘。
手机游戏开发的基本流程
要开发一款手机游戏,首先需要明确游戏的类型和风格。是休闲益智类,还是动作冒险类?确定游戏类型之后,就要进行游戏设计和规划,包括制定游戏的故事情节、角色设计、关卡设置等。接下来便是编码开发,开发者可以选择合适的开发工具,比如Unity 3D、Cocos2d-x等,根据游戏设计编写程序代码,实现游戏的各种功能和交互。
常用开发工具和技术
在手机游戏开发中,常用的开发工具包括Unity 3D、Unreal Engine、Cocos2d-x等,它们提供了丰富的游戏开发资源和强大的开发功能,极大地简化了游戏开发的流程。另外,掌握好C#、C++等编程语言也是至关重要的,这些语言常用于手机游戏的逻辑编写和性能优化。
手机游戏开发的技巧与经验
除了掌握开发工具和编程语言,在手机游戏开发过程中,还需要注意游戏性能的优化、用户体验的提升以及营销推广等方面。比如,要注意游戏的流畅度和稳定性,避免卡顿和闪退;要注重游戏的美术设计和音效效果,给玩家带来良好的视听体验;同时,也要制定合理的营销策略,让更多的玩家了解并喜爱你的游戏。
结语
通过本文的介绍,相信读者已经对手机游戏开发有了一定的了解。开发手机游戏是一项充满乐趣和挑战的工作,希望本文所传达的知识可以帮助到有志于从事手机游戏开发的朋友们。感谢您的阅读和支持!
二、手机游戏编程制作怎么学?
想要学习手机游戏编程最好就是去培训学校,我就是在上海博思游戏学校学的,教的挺好而且推荐就业,你要是想自学的话是很难的,因此游戏编程主要是运用各类计算机语言,没有基础的话入门是很困难的。
目前流行的游戏编程语言为C++编程语言,目前流行的游戏编程接口为DirectX9.0,还有OpenGL、SDL(Simple DirectMedia Layer)等。
现在手机上玩的游戏分为Android与IOS两种不同平台,分别是用eclipse/MyEclipse和xcode。
现在也流行一些跨平台的编程引擎,例如cocos2d-x、unity 3D等,这些都是比较复杂的。
三、如何学习手机游戏编程制作?全面解读手机游戏编程技术
探索手机游戏编程制作的魅力
手机游戏在当今社会已经成为人们日常娱乐生活中不可或缺的一部分。作为一名开发者,想要进入手机游戏编程制作行业,首先需要了解手机游戏编程的基本原理和技术,这不仅有利于提高开发效率和质量,还可以在激烈的市场竞争中脱颖而出。
学习手机游戏编程制作的基本知识
要想成为一名优秀的手机游戏编程制作人员,必须具备扎实的编程基础,掌握游戏开发相关知识。首先,需要学习掌握常见的编程语言,如Java、C#等,在此基础上学习游戏开发引擎,比如Unity、Unreal Engine等。还需要了解游戏设计、图形学等相关知识。
手机游戏编程制作的技术实践
实际操作是学习手机游戏编程制作不可或缺的一环。可以通过制作小型游戏项目来提升自己的编程技能,同时也要学会阅读他人的游戏源代码,理解优秀游戏的编程设计,这对于提升自己的编程水平非常有帮助。
不断学习与实践
手机游戏编程制作行业一直在不断发展和变化,因此作为从业人员需要保持对新技术的学习和实践。可以通过持续学习新的编程语言、新的开发工具和技术,参与开发社区,深入了解行业动态,才能保持竞争力。
深入学习手机游戏编程制作需要不断的努力和实践,但只要坚持不懈,相信一定能够成为一名优秀的手机游戏编程制作人员。
感谢您阅读本文,希望通过这篇文章,能够帮助您更好地了解手机游戏编程制作的技术要点和学习方法。
四、编程猫怎么编程游戏?
创建游戏场景。我们可以使用编程猫的简单的图形绘制工具,来创建一些基本的图形元素,比如矩形和圆形等等。接下来,我们可以将图形元素组合起来,形成一个完整的游戏场景,比如一个迷宫。
第二步是定义角色。在游戏之中,我们需要定义一些角色,比如主人公和敌人、精灵或其他。我们可以使用编程猫提供的角色编辑器,来编辑图形元素,或者通过代码来创建。
第三步是编写游戏逻辑。
五、python编程游戏?
CodeCombat是一个让学生通过玩游戏学习编程的平台,CodeCombat课程已通过特别测试,足够满足教学需求,无编程经验的教师也可掌控。CodeCombat是完全开源的HTML5编程游戏!(支持Python,JS,HTML等等语言)
基于浏览器的游戏,你需要使用 Python 或 JavaScript 来解决问题才能将游戏进行下去(需要登录)。
六、如何编程游戏?
编程游戏要具备以下6点:
首先要学习看数据的结构,不用学的很深入。在实践中慢慢深化。
学下sdl,这个只要看着网上的教程就可以编一些简单的程序。
多练习编程,可以从小的游戏慢慢编写。
英语一定好,因为很多自学编程的书都是英文的。
大量的练习算法,把编程树学完就足够了。
写游戏的时候,要搞明白引擎的构架,大量的写游戏。
七、游戏编程入门?
1、首先建议先学习下出C++语言。
2、如果想只是做windows方面的游戏学习,可以学习下DirectX,这个很方便在windows下做游戏开发。
3、如果要制作跨平台游戏,建议学习下opengl/opengles,这是个很强大很专业的图形接口,因为很多平台支持所以适合跨平台游戏制作使用。
4、然后接着要是想学习3d游戏并迅速工作,建议学习u3d引擎、ue引擎这些游戏引擎,有了以上的基础,学习这些引擎也可以理解的更深入,u3d还会用到c#与js语言。
5、做2d游戏,可以使用cocos2dx等一些引擎,当然你也可以使用上面的3d引擎制作2d游戏。
6、然后就是可以深入的研究一些开源的游戏引擎,终极目标是可以自己做出一款比较棒的游戏引擎。
八、怎么编程游戏?
1 编程游戏的方法有很多种,但是其中一种常用的方法是使用编程语言来实现游戏逻辑和功能。2 编程游戏需要掌握一门编程语言,比如Python、C++等,以及相关的开发工具和框架。通过编写代码来实现游戏的各种功能,比如角色移动、碰撞检测、游戏界面等。3 在编程游戏的过程中,需要了解游戏设计的基本原理和规则,包括游戏的目标、玩法、关卡设计等。同时,还需要学习一些算法和数据结构,以优化游戏的性能和用户体验。4 此外,可以参考一些游戏开发的教程和资源,如在线教程、书籍、开发者社区等,来获取更多的编程游戏的知识和经验。5 最后,编程游戏是一个需要不断学习和实践的过程,通过不断的尝试和改进,可以逐渐提升自己的编程能力和游戏开发技巧。
九、游戏怎么编程?
编程游戏要具备以下6点:
首先要学习看数据的结构,不用学的很深入。在实践中慢慢深化。
学下sdl,这个只要看着网上的教程就可以编一些简单的程序。
多练习编程,可以从小的游戏慢慢编写。
英语一定好,因为很多自学编程的书都是英文的。
大量的练习算法,把编程树学完就足够了。
写游戏的时候,要搞明白引擎的构架,大量的写游戏
十、自学Java自学手机游戏编程如何起步?
其实这个问题取决于你自己,如果你平常时间充裕而且自制力特别强,当然可以自学,但是自学的话会有一些问题,比如说学习过程中遇到问题出了 bug 该如何解决?自己是不是能够坚持下来? 去正规培训机构学当然也成